MySQL是一款被廣泛使用的關系型數據庫管理系統,它提供了很多功能來優化和管理數據,其中存儲過程是其中一項常用的功能。但是,有時候我們需要停止存儲過程,那么我們該怎么做呢?
首先,我們需要連接到MySQL服務器,并執行以下命令:
STOP PROCEDURE procedure_name;
其中,procedure_name是指要停止的存儲過程的名稱。如果該存儲過程正在運行,那么它會被停止并且不能再被調用。如果該存儲過程沒有在運行,那么該命令僅僅是一個空操作。
需要注意的是,停止存儲過程僅僅是停止當前正在運行的存儲過程實例,而不會刪除該存儲過程。如果需要刪除存儲過程,請使用DROP PROCEDURE命令。
如果想要查看當前數據庫中所有的存儲過程,可以使用SHOW PROCEDURE STATUS命令。該命令將列出每個存儲過程的名稱、參數、創建日期、修改日期以及狀態等信息。
總之,停止存儲過程可以讓我們更好地控制MySQL數據庫的操作,以及避免一些不必要的錯誤發生。